McRae Industries, Inc. Receives Government Contract
August 03, 2023 at 11:51 am EDT
Share
McRae Industries, Inc. has been awarded by the Defense Logistics Agency of the United States Government, an estimated $20,465,795 firm-fixed-price, indefinite-delivery/indefinite-quantity contract for Army hot weather combat boots. The contract has a three year ordering period. Within the three year ordering period, there are three one-year tier periods.
